Is Visiting Lots of Bridal Shops the Best Approach?

It can feel sensible to visit five or six bridal shops “just to be sure.”


In reality, what often happens is:

  • The gorgeous dresses start to blur into one

  • You can’t remember which gown was at which boutique

  • Small differences feel overwhelming

  • You begin second guessing your instinct


Wedding dress shopping should feel exciting and affirming - not confusing and where possible not overwhelming.


For most brides, one, two to three carefully chosen bridal boutiques are more than enough.


How to Choose the Right Bridal Boutiques in Manchester

Instead of booking every bridal appointment available, try being intentional.


Before confirming, consider:

  • Does the boutique’s aesthetic align with yours?

  • Are the gowns within your budget?

  • Is the experience private and relaxed, or busy and fast-paced?

Can Too Many Bridal Appointments Cause Overwhelm?

Booking multiple bridal appointments can sometimes create pressure without you realising. You might find yourself thinking:

  • “What if there’s something better elsewhere?”

  • “Should I keep looking just in case?”

  • “Am I deciding too quickly?”


Here’s something I gently remind brides: If you fall in love with a dress at your first bridal appointment, that doesn’t mean it’s rushed. It simply means it felt right.

How many bridal boutiques should I visit in Manchester?

Most brides find that visiting two to three Manchester bridal boutiques is more than enough to feel confident in their decision.


Is it bad to buy your wedding dress at your first appointment?

Not at all. If you feel calm and certain, it’s a strong sign you’ve found the right dress.


When should I start wedding dress shopping in Manchester?

Ideally 12–18 months before your wedding to allow time for ordering and alterations.
